    Michael J. Kennedy (1900–1978) was an Irish player of the melodeon (one-row diatonic accordion). Kennedy was born in Flaskagh Beag in County Galway , and at age 11 took up playing the melodeon. In 1923 he emigrated to Cincinnati in the United States, and spent his career there working for the Louisville and Nashville Railroad .

    Michael Joseph Kennedy (October 25, 1897 – November 1, 1949) was an American businessman and politician. He was a member of the United States House of Representatives from the state of New York from 1939 to 1943.
